Very good video! Just one question how do you keep it straight? When I done this I switched the angle to look from above and it was all crooked.. any tips?
Did you click the axis gimble in the upper right-hand corner? I do a lot of rotating too and sometimes the angles get wonky and I click the -Y axis on that gimble to square my view up.
@@artwithmckenzie I only clicked it once I had completed it. You mean to click it each time I extrude or move ?
I thought you meant the viewing angle changed. If it’s about the extrusion process you should be able to just hit E to extrude and it will extrude on the angle you’re looking at. To keep it along the axis regardless of how you’re viewing it, hit E then the axis you want to extrude it to. So… E X … this will extrude on the X axis.
This works thank you so much was giving me grief kept making a very crooked looking claw 😅
